| dc.description | By making use of some techniques based upon certain inverse new pairs of symbolic operators, the author investigate several decomposition formulas associated with Humbert hypergeometric functions $Φ_1 $, $Φ_2 $, $Φ_3 $, $Ψ_1 $, $Ψ_2 $, $Ξ_1 $ and $Ξ_2 $. These operational representations are constructed and applied in order to derive the corresponding decomposition formulas. With the help of these inverse pairs of symbolic operators, a total 34 decomposition formulas are found. Euler type integrals, which are connected with Humbert's functions are found. | |
